
Lee Madgwick Paints Eerie, Abandoned Buildings Beneath Heavy Skies
Beneath heavy skies, Lee Madgwick paints the English countryside as if caught in a quiet dream. His Norfolk landscapes stretch flat and green, anchored by lone brick buildings whose walls crumble, hover, or drift apart. Each scene feels frozen in an uneasy calm.
